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Arabian oryx | Brolga |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um same | Chordata (Chordates) | Chordata (Chordates) |
| Class | Mammalia (Mammals) | Aves (Birds) |
| Order | Artiodactyla (Even-toed Ungulates) | Gruiformes (Gruiformes) |
| Family | Bovidae (Bovids) | Gruidae |
| Genus | Oryx | Grus |
| Species | Oryx leucoryx | Grus rubicunda |
